About

NARITA@amata is a budget-friendly hotel located in the Don Hua Lo district, near the Amata Industrial Estate. It's described as clean, quiet, and offers comfortable rooms with amenities like microwaves and refrigerators. The hotel is relatively easy to access but might be slightly difficult to find based on GPS coordinates. The staff are consistently praised for their friendliness and helpfulness.

Reviews Summary

Overall, reviews are overwhelmingly positive, highlighting the hotel's cleanliness, affordability, and friendly staff. Guests appreciate the convenient location for those working in or visiting the Amata Industrial Estate. The rooms are described as comfortable and well-equipped.
